Culinary Delights: Exploring Chester's Food and Drink Festivals
For gastronomes, the Chester festivals calendar offers an irresistible array of culinary celebrations that highlight the region's rich agricultural bounty and innovative chefs. Undoubtedly, the highlight is the Chester Food, Drink & Lifestyle Festival, typically held over the Easter bank holiday weekend. This renowned event transforms the Chester Racecourse into a bustling marketplace, featuring hundreds of exhibitors showcasing artisanal produce, street food, craft beverages, and live cooking demonstrations. Rhythmic Beats: Dive into Chester's Music Festival Scene
Chester resonates with an impressive array of musical talent and events, making its music festivals a significant draw for sound enthusiasts. The city offers diverse sonic experiences, from classical and jazz to contemporary and folk genres, truly catering to all auditory preferences. A standout event is the Chester Music Festival, usually presented by Storyhouse, which brings world-class orchestral performances, chamber music, and recitals to the city's most iconic venues during the summer months. These sophisticated Chester gigs often feature renowned musicians and emerging artists, establishing Chester as a hub for musical excellence. Seasonal Spectacles: When to Experience Chester's Best Festivals
The beauty of Chester festivals lies in their year-round appeal, with each season bringing its own unique charm and calendar of events. Spring bursts forth with the highly anticipated Chester Food, Drink & Lifestyle Festival, setting a vibrant tone for the warmer months. As flowers bloom, numerous smaller craft fairs and local markets also emerge, offering delightful opportunities for discovery. Summer, undeniably, is peak festival season in Chester, characterized by open-air music concerts, historical re-enactments like the Roman parades, and the Storyhouse outdoor theatre productions. The longer days and pleasant weather perfectly complement these lively Chester events, drawing large crowds.
Autumn ushers in a more reflective, cultural period, with the Chester Literature Festival taking centre stage, alongside various arts and heritage events that delve into the city's rich past. The changing leaves provide a picturesque backdrop to these thought-provoking gatherings. Finally, winter transforms Chester into a magical wonderland, highlighted by the enchanting Christmas Market around the Cathedral and festive light switch-on events.
